SF Giants’ Schmitt returns from injured list, Fitzgerald optioned to Triple-A

SAN FRANCISCO Casey Schmitt won t be the Giants starting third baseman now that Matt Chapman is back from the injured list but another starting opportunity awaits The Giants informed on Monday afternoon that Schmitt has been activated off the -day injured list after the infielder dealt with left hand inflammation for the last week-and-a-half Schmitt will hit sixth and start at second base in his first tournament back presumably beginning his time as San Francisco s starting second baseman In a corresponding move San Francisco optioned infielder Tyler Fitzgerald to Triple-A Sacramento Additionally catcher Logan Porter cleared waivers elected free agency and re-signed a minor-league contract Before landing on the injured list himself Schmitt played his way into the starting lineup by excelling in Chapman s absence In games as Chapman s replacement Schmitt hit with four homers and RBIs before being plunked in the left hand by the Miami Marlins Calvin Faucher on June Schmitt played two rehab games with Triple-A Sacramento this weekend against the Reno Aces going -for- with three walks Check back for additional updates
